Salesforce Tower - Clark Construction along with joint venture partner Hathaway Dinwiddie Construction Company (Clark/Hathaway) selected Olson Steel to handle all miscellaneous metals for the Salesforce Tower at 101 1st Street. The 61-story Class-A office tower would be the tallest building in the western United States at 1,070 feet, rising above the adjacent transit center in downtown San Francisco.

U.C Davis Shrem Museum - Whiting Turner selects Olson Steel to help design and erect state of the art Shrem Museum designed by New York-based design firm, SO IL and Bohlin Cywinski Jackson, a prominent architectural firm from San Francisco.
